Crisis Clinician 2 Job Description

Job Summary:

The Marion County Crisis Center is seeking a skilled Crisis Clinician 2 to provide crisis mental health assessments, treatment, and case management services to individuals and families in need. This is an overnight position that requires a strong understanding of community mental health concepts, individual assessment, treatment planning, and treatment protocols.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ide counseling by telephone or in-person to individuals and/or their families or concerned others.
  • Intervene with both children and adults, addressing a wide range of personal needs and presenting problems.
  • Perform independent assessments of mental status, diagnosis, level of functioning, dangerousness, and specific needs for service.
  • Develop plans with clients/families to address immediate needs and plans to obtain services.
  • Maintain current knowledge of community agencies to make referrals appropriately.
  • Provide advocacy for client rights, ethical considerations, and least restrictive care-intervention.

Requirements:

  • Possession of a Master's degree in Psychology, Social Work, Recreational Therapy, Music Therapy, Art Therapy, or a behavioral science field.
  • At least one year of full-time, post-Master's degree experience in the behavioral health field.
  • Knowledge of community mental health concepts, individual assessment, treatment planning, and treatment protocols.
  • Ability to establish positive working relationships with other employees, individuals, and their families, other agencies, and the public.

Working Conditions:

This position requires working in areas that may be exposed to heat, cold, humidity, dust, and chemicals. The employee must be able to operate a motor vehicle, see using depth perception, stand, sit, move about the work area, climb 1 floor of stairs, lift, push, and pull up to 20 lbs., carry up to 10 lbs., move carts weighing up to 20 lbs., operate a keyboard, speak clearly and audibly, read a 12 pt. font, hear a normal level of speech, and work in areas that may be exposed to heat, cold, humidity, dust, and chemicals.
